Confirmed users
383
edits
Line 305: | Line 305: | ||
=== Day 6: 3rd June === | === Day 6: 3rd June === | ||
====Steve==== | |||
* {{Bug|1169541}} - [Messages] [NGA] Refine the thread query and move draft query/getThreads API into conversation service / messaging service | |||
** waiting for the clear picture about service draft spec | |||
* {{Bug|1169573}} - [Messages][NG] Lay out Messaging service structure | |||
** Create a patch for wrapping the current message manager. But we definitely need conclusion in {{Bug|1169543}} first. | |||
* Reviewed markup extract part. | |||
* Reading the comment from spec drafts. | |||
* {{Bug|1167144}} - [Messages] Reduce the use of Threads.active and Threads.currentId in conversation view | |||
** No new progress yet | |||
Today: | |||
* Reviewing the activity service, just have one question for the overall structure, will look deeper then. | |||
* Give some early thought about loading threads. | |||
* Clean up the use of threads.active in conversation view | |||
* Some tasks for background if I have time | |||
** Fix the attachment menu for closing the option menu manually | |||
** gaia-component stuff | |||
** file loading in Template.js | |||
====Julien==== | |||
* discussed about {{Bug|1168441}} about ActivityService | |||
* spent time on {{Bug|818000}} to have a good proposal about system messages (not in SW) | |||
* spent time to write a mail about activities in a URL and Service Worker world: https://groups.google.com/d/msg/mozilla.dev.webapi/JUlLSCD4fRo/5NjKEaWzwKYJ | |||
:(Oleg) Sounds interesting! Looks like we need Cross Origin SW for this? | |||
:(Julien) I don't think so, because Gecko would have a role of proxy here. | |||
:(Steve) It's a really interesting thought :) | |||
:(Julien) Thanks ! there are perf implications though, as Andrew said ;) will see if this gives something... | |||
Others: | |||
* tried b2gdroid on my old Android phone (that I had to update) | |||
:(Oleg) I was actually able to run from the second try, sms crashes it :) Submitted bug. I'm also wondering if we tried to add "native" support for FxOS into MultiRom app as Ubuntu Touch did. | |||
:(Julien) yeah I think it uses directly mozMobileMessaging Android implementation -- and I think this is mostly untested these days | |||
* tried also WebIDE with Firefox Nightly on Android and Chrome on Android -- but couldn't make it work with iOS | |||
Today: | |||
I want to: | |||
* do asked reviews/needinfo | |||
* I'll maybe do a simple patch for {{Bug|1146393}} for spark now that people dogfood. | |||
* pick a bug for the sprint | |||
If all this moves forward well, I could: | |||
* continue the prototype caching the thread list to a single db (including contacts/drafts/etc). | |||
* I'd like to work on the deduplication logic for network alerts, it seems important for users ({{Bug|1067938}}) | |||
====Oleg==== | |||
Not really productive day, but it's ok assuming how much things we have to discuss and sort out :) | |||
* {{Bug|1162028}} - [Messages][New Gaia Architecture] extract conversation/index.html | |||
** Got feedback from Steve (awaiting feedback); | |||
** Moved forward with "modular startup" so that we not lazy load files in separated views that we don't need, it's in WIP stage, bug you can check https://github.com/mozilla-b2g/gaia/pull/30381 to see what's happening (in progress). | |||
* {{Bug|1168441}} - [Messages][NG] Implement ActivityService | |||
** Intensive discussion about activity service and its future with Julien (in review). | |||
** Let's continue discussion today on IRC. | |||
* {{Bug|1168941}} - [Messages] Conversation view is rendered incorrectly when user tries to send message from Participants view | |||
** Added checkin-needed for the sheriffs to land (almost landed). | |||
Other: | |||
* More discussion around service spec. | |||
Today: | |||
* Will handle review/feedback/need-info requests; | |||
* Will work on review comments and assigned bugs. | |||
=== Day 7: 4th June === | === Day 7: 4th June === | ||
=== Day 8: 5th June === | === Day 8: 5th June === |